Narrow Sea
A relatively small and elongated body of seawater that lies between two landmasses, often acting as a natural border.
Volcanic Islands
Islands formed by volcanic processes above the sea level, often at hot spots or oceanic plate boundaries.
Oceanic Plateau
A large, high-standing, submarine plateau formed by volcanic activity and consisting mainly of basalt.
Abyssal Plain
A large, flat, almost level area of the deep-ocean floor, usually found at depths between 3,000 meters and 6,000 meters.
